And the question How do you do? Should we answer in the same way?
@RealLifeEnglish1
@RealLifeEnglish1 Ай бұрын
The formal greeting "How do you do?" is rarely used in contemporary conversation. It is considered old-fashioned and has largely been replaced by more modern greetings like "How are you?" or "Nice to meet you." The expected response is usually another "How do you do?"
